Green parakeets are an increasingly common sight in south east England. They are considered to be a pest, but I never tire of seeing them. I took this from my bedroom window this morning. The parakeet spent a few minutes on the tree across the road before something startled it. There have been numerous theories about why green parakeets have become part of Britain's bird population (some blaming Jimi Hendrix, or the filming of The African Queen!)but this BBC article explains why they are more prevalent: https://www.bbc.co.uk/news/uk-england-50755015
